közzétéve: 5 éveHey there!
Thank you kindly for the great review!
In order for an extension to be recommended, it must have a non-paid/free option to use, but since 1Password X requires a membership account, it does not qualify for that “Recommended” badge.

közzétéve: 5 éveHey there!
It sounds like you might have a local vault in your desktop app, while the extension only works directly with your 1Password.com account.
You’ll want to migrate your data from the local vault to your 1Password.com account’s vault, then you’ll see all your logins in the extension: https://support.1password.com/migrate-1password-account/ - Csillagos értékelés: 5 / 5készítette: William Landcaster, 5 éve
